Position Overview :
Are you passionate about making a difference in the lives of individuals with developmental disabilities? Do you have a heart for helping others achieve independence and success in the workplace? If so, we invite you to apply for the Job Coach position.
As a Job Coach, you will work directly with individuals with developmental disabilities, providing them with the support, guidance, and skills necessary to gain and maintain meaningful employment. You will be a vital part of our team, helping clients thrive in their work environments and promoting workplace inclusivity.
Please note : This position starts as part-time , but there is the potential to transition to full-time based on client needs and performance. The role is an on-the-road position, which means you will be traveling to various job sites and locations to provide direct support to clients. A valid driver's license and reliable transportation are required.
Additionally, we are committed to your ongoing professional development, offering ongoing training with The Boggs Center and in-house training to ensure you are equipped with the best tools and knowledge to succeed in your role. CPR certification is required for this position.
Key Responsibilities :
Provide Personalized Job Coaching : Work closely with individuals to teach job skills, improve workplace behaviors, and promote confidence and independence in their roles.Support Clients in the Workplace : Assist clients in transitioning into and maintaining their jobs, offering on-the-job training, feedback, and ongoing support.Collaborate with Employers : Ensure that clients are meeting job expectations and provide assistance with any workplace challenges or concerns.Maintain Documentation : Track client progress, document achievements, and provide regular reports on their development and goals.Advocate for Clients : Support individuals in self-advocacy and ensure that their needs are met within the work environment.Qualifications :
